Choosing the Right Paint for Your 3D Prints

Not all paints are created equal, especially when it comes to 3D printed materials. Here are some common types of paint used for 3D printing:

  • Acrylic Paint: Water-based and easy to work with, acrylics are popular for their quick drying time.
  • Enamel Paint: Oil-based and durable, enamel paints offer a glossy finish but require longer drying time.
  • Spray Paint: Ideal for large projects, spray paint provides an even coat and is available in various finishes.
  • Specialty Paints: Products specifically designed for plastics can enhance adhesion and durability.

Surface Preparation: The Key to Adhesion

Before applying paint, proper surface preparation is vital to ensure good adhesion and a smooth finish. Here’s how to prepare your 3D printed items:

1. Cleaning the Surface

Remove any dust, grease, or residues from the print. You can use:

  • A mild soap solution and a soft cloth.
  • Isopropyl alcohol for stubborn residues.

2. Sanding

Sanding helps create a smooth surface and improves paint adhesion. Follow these steps:

  • Start with coarse sandpaper (around 100-200 grit) to remove any layer lines.
  • Progress to finer grit (400-600 grit) for a smooth finish.

3. Priming

Applying a primer can enhance adhesion and provide a uniform base for your paint. Choose a primer compatible with your chosen paint type. Spray primers are often the easiest to apply. Allow it to dry completely before moving on to painting.

Painting Techniques for 3D Prints

Once your surface is prepped, it’s time to paint. Here are some effective techniques:

Brushing vs. Spraying

Brushing is ideal for detailed work, while spraying provides an even coat and is quicker for larger surfaces. Consider the following:

  • Brushing: Use high-quality brushes to avoid streaks.
  • Spraying: Maintain a consistent distance from the surface to avoid drips.

Layering Colors

For more complex designs, layering different colors can create depth. Start with a base coat and allow it to dry before adding layers. You can use techniques like:

  • Dry Brushing: Lightly brush on a lighter color to highlight details.
  • Wash Technique: Apply a diluted paint to settle in the crevices for added dimension.

Finishing Touches

Once the paint has dried, consider adding a clear coat to protect your work. Options include:

  • Matte Finish: Reduces glare and provides a more subtle look.
  • Gloss Finish: Enhances colors and provides a shiny, polished appearance.
  • Satin Finish: A balanced option between matte and gloss.

Troubleshooting Common Issues

Even with the best preparation, you may face challenges when painting your 3D prints. Here are some common issues and their solutions:

1. Paint Peeling or Chipping

This can often be attributed to poor surface preparation or incompatible paint types. Ensure you:

  • Thoroughly clean and sand your prints.
  • Use a primer suitable for the material.

2. Uneven Application

Uneven paint application can result from improper technique. To avoid this:

  • Maintain a steady hand when brushing.
  • Keep a consistent distance when spraying.

3. Color Mismatch

If the final color doesn’t match your expectations, try:

  • Mixing paints to achieve the desired hue.
  • Layering colors for depth and variation.
